Determination of pH in Soft Drinks
Measuring the pH in soft drinks is important to ensure product quality, safety, and stability.
An acidic pH (generally between 2.5 and 4) helps prevent the growth of microorganisms, prolonging the shelf life of the beverage. It also affects taste, the effectiveness of preservatives, and the stability of flavors and colors. Keeping pH under control is essential to ensuring a safe and pleasant product for the consumer.

Principle of the test
The determination of the pH value is carried out through a colorimetric acid-base reaction in which a chemical compound, added to the matrix to be analyzed, causes a change in color. The extent of the coloration, measured at 520 nm, is related to the pH of the sample.
